Activating Adaptive Cruise Control (ACC)
The minimum set speed for the ACC system is 20 mph
(32 km/h).
When the system is turned on and in the ready state, the
instrument cluster display will read “ACC Ready.”
When the system is off, the instrument cluster display will
read “Adaptive Cruise Control (ACC) Off.”
NOTE:You cannot engage ACC under the following conditions:
When in 4WD Low
When the brakes are applied
When the parking brake is applied
When the automatic transmission is in PARK, REVERSE
or NEUTRAL
When the brakes are overheated
When the driver’s door is open at low speeds
When the driver’s seat belt is unbuckled at low speeds
When there is a stationary vehicle in front of your
vehicle in close proximity
When ESC Full Off mode is active
To Activate/Deactivate
Push and release the Adaptive Cruise Control (ACC) on/off
button. The ACC menu in the instrument cluster displays
“ACC Ready.”
To turn the system off, push and release the Adaptive
Cruise Control (ACC) on/off button again. At this time, the
system will turn off and the instrument cluster displays
“Adaptive Cruise Control (ACC) Off.”
To Set A Desired Speed
When the vehicle reaches the speed desired, push the
SET (+) button or the SET (-) button and release. The
instrument cluster display will show the set speed.
NOTE:Fixed Speed Cruise Control (if equipped) can be used
without ACC enabled. To change between the different
modes, push the ACC on/off button which turns the ACC
and the Fixed Speed Cruise Control off. Pushing the Fixed
Speed Cruise Control on/off button will result in turning on
(changing to) Fixed Speed Cruise Control mode. If ACC is set when the vehicle speed is
below 20 mph
(32 km/h), the set speed will default to 20 mph
(32 km/h).
NOTE:Fixed Speed Cruise Control cannot be set below 20 mph
(32 km/h).
If either system is set when the vehicle speed is above
20 mph (32 km/h), the set speed shall be the current speed of the vehicle.
NOTE:
Keeping your foot on the accelerator pedal can cause
the vehicle to continue to accelerate beyond the set
speed. If this occurs, the message “DRIVER OVERRIDE”
will display in the instrument cluster display.
If you continue to accelerate beyond the set speed
while ACC is enabled, the system will not be controlling
the distance between your vehicle and the vehicle
ahead. The vehicle speed will only be determined by
the position of the accelerator pedal.
To Cancel
The following conditions cancel the ACC or Fixed Speed
Cruise Control systems:
The brake pedal is applied
The CANC (cancel) button is pushed
The Anti-Lock Brake System (ABS) activates
The gear selector is removed from the DRIVE position
WARNING!
Leaving the Adaptive Cruise Control (ACC) system on
when not in use is dangerous. You could accidentally
set the system or cause it to go faster than you want.
You could lose control and have a collision. Always leave
the system off when you are not using it.
WARNING!
In Fixed Speed Cruise Control mode, the system will not
react to vehicles ahead. In addition, the proximity
warning does not activate and no alarm will sound even
if you are too close to the vehicle ahead since neither
the presence of the vehicle ahead nor the
vehicle-to-vehicle distance is detected. Be sure to
maintain a safe distance between your vehicle and the
vehicle ahead. Always be aware which mode is
selected.

NOTE:
If your vehicle is at a standstill for longer than two
seconds, the system will hold brake pressure for up to
10 minutes. If no driver action is taken after the
10 minutes, the Electric Park Brake will be applied and
the ACC system will cancel.
While ACC is holding your vehicle at a standstill (or the
vehicle is traveling below 3 mph (5 km/h), and the
driver seat belt is unbuckled or the driver door is
opened, the Electric Park Brake will be applied and the
ACC system will cancel.
Display Warnings And Maintenance
“WIPE FRONT RADAR SENSOR IN FRONT OF
VEHICLE” WARNING
The “ACC Unavailable Wipe Front Radar Sensor” warning
will display and a chime will sound when conditions
temporarily limit system performance.
This most often occurs at times of poor visibility, such as
in snow or heavy rain. The ACC system may also become
temporarily blinded due to obstructions, such as mud, dirt
or ice. In these cases, the instrument cluster display will
display this message and the system will deactivate. This message can sometimes be displayed while driving in
highly reflective areas (i.e. ice and snow, or tunnels with
reflective tiles). The ACC system will recover after the
vehicle has left these areas. Under rare conditions, when
the radar is not tracking any vehicles or objects in its path
this warning may temporarily occur.
NOTE:If the “ACC Unavailable Wipe Front Radar Sensor” warning
is active, Fixed Speed Cruise Control is still available.
If weather conditions are not a factor, the driver should
examine the sensor. It may require cleaning or removal of
an obstruction. The sensor is located in the center of the
vehicle behind the lower grille.
To keep the ACC System operating properly, it is important
to note the following maintenance items:
Always keep the sensor clean. Carefully wipe the
sensor lens with a soft cloth. Be cautious not to
damage the sensor lens.
Do not remove any screws from the sensor. Doing so
could cause an ACC system malfunction or failure and
require a sensor realignment.
If the sensor or front end of the vehicle is damaged due
to a collision, see your authorized dealer for service.
Do not attach or install any accessories near the
sensor, including transparent material or aftermarket
grilles. Doing so could cause an ACC system failure or
malfunction. When the condition that deactivated the system is no
longer present, the system will return to the “Adaptive
Cruise Control Off” state and will resume function by
simply reactivating it.
NOTE:
If the “ACC Unavailable Wipe Front Radar Sensor”
message occurs frequently (e.g. more than once on
every trip) without any snow, rain, mud, or other
obstruction, have the radar sensor realigned at an
authorized dealer.
Installing a snowplow, front-end protector, an after -
market grille or modifying the grille is not recom -
mended. Doing so may block the sensor and inhibit
ACC operation.
“CLEAN FRONT WINDSHIELD” WARNING
The “ACC Limited Functionality Clean Front Windshield”
warning will display, and a chime will sound when
conditions temporarily limit system performance. This
most often occurs at times of poor visibility, such as in
snow or heavy rain and fog. The ACC system may also
become temporarily blinded due to obstructions, such as
mud, dirt, or ice on windshield and fog on the inside of
glass. In these cases, the instrument cluster display will
read “ACC Limited Functionality Clean Front Windshield”
and the system will have degraded performance.
This message can sometimes be displayed while driving in
adverse weather conditions. The ACC system will recover
after the vehicle has left these areas. Under rare
conditions, when the camera is not tracking any vehicles
or objects in its path this warning may temporarily occur.
WARNING!
When the ACC system is resumed, the driver must
ensure that there are no pedestrians, vehicles or
objects in the path of the vehicle. Failure to follow these
warnings can result in a collision and death or serious
personal injury.

The system may not work in all conditions (e.g. environ -
mental conditions such as heavy rain, snow, etc., or if
searching for a parking space that has surfaces that
will absorb the ultrasonic sensor waves).
New vehicles from the dealership must have at least
30 miles (48 km) accumulated before the ParkSense
Active Park Assist system is fully calibrated and
performs accurately. This is due to the system’s
dynamic vehicle calibration to improve the perfor -
mance of the feature. The system will also continuously
perform the dynamic vehicle calibration to account for
differences such as over or under inflated tires and
new tires.
ENABLING AND DISABLING THE
P
ARKSENSE ACTIVE PARK ASSIST
S
YSTEM
The ParkSense Active Park Assist system can
be enabled and disabled with the ParkSense
Active Park Assist switch, located on the switch
panel on the forward part of the center console,
in front of the gear selector.
To enable the ParkSense Active Park Assist system, push
the ParkSense Active Park Assist switch once (LED turns
on). Pushing the switch a second time will disable the
system (LED turns off).
The ParkSense Active Park Assist system will turn off
automatically for any of the following conditions:
Parking maneuver is completed
Vehicle speed is greater than 28 mph (45 km/h) when
searching for a parking space during a Fully Automated
maneuver
Vehicle speed is greater than 18 mph (30 km/h) when
searching for a parking space during a Semi-Automatic
maneuver
Vehicle speed is greater than 5 mph (7 km/h) during
Semi-Automatic active steering guidance into the
parking space
Steering wheel is touched during Fully Automated or
Semi-Automatic active steering guidance into the
parking space
The gas pedal or brake pedal is pressed during Fully
Automated active steering guidance into the parking
space
ParkSense Front and Rear Park Assist switch is pushed
Any of the doors are opened during a Fully Automated
maneuver
The driver door is opened during a Semi-Automatic
maneuver
Rear liftgate is opened
A trailer is connected
Vehicle is in 4WD Low
Cruise Control, Adaptive Cruise Control, or Active
Driving Assist systems are engaged
Electronic Stability Control/Anti-Lock Braking System
intervention
The ParkSense Active Park Assist system allows a
maximum number of shifts between DRIVE and REVERSE.
If the maneuver cannot be completed within the maximum
amount of shifts, the system will cancel and the
instrument cluster display will instruct the driver to
complete the maneuver manually. The ParkSense Active Park Assist system will only operate
and search for a parking space when the following
conditions are present:
Gear selector is in DRIVE
Ignition is in the RUN position
ParkSense Active Park Assist switch is activated
All of the doors are closed
Rear liftgate is closed
Vehicle speed is less than 15 mph (25 km/h) during a
Semi-Automatic maneuver
Vehicle speed is less than 25 mph (40 km/h) during a
Fully Automated maneuver
The outer surface and the underside of the front and
rear fascias/bumpers are clean and clear of snow, ice,
mud, dirt or other obstruction
NOTE:
During a Semi-Automatic maneuver, if the vehicle is
driven above approximately 15 mph (25 km/h), the
instrument cluster display will instruct the driver to
slow down. If the vehicle is driven above approximately
18 mph (30 km/h), the system will cancel. The driver
must then reactivate the system by pushing the Park -
Sense Active Park Assist switch.
During a Fully Automated maneuver, if the vehicle is
driven above approximately 25 mph (40 km/h), the
instrument cluster display will instruct the driver to
slow down. If the vehicle is driven above approximately
28 mph (45 km/h), the system will cancel. The driver
must then reactivate the system by pushing the Park -
Sense Active Park Assist switch.

NOTE:
The Active Lane Management system operates with
similar behavior for a right lane departure.
If the turn signal is activated, and the vehicle begins to
depart the lane at the same time the Blind Spot Moni -
toring (BSM) system detects another vehicle in the
BSM zones, the system will provide haptic steering
wheel vibration and/or steering assist torque (if
programmed in Uconnect Settings).
CHANGING ACTIVE LANE MANAGEMENT
S
TATUS
Configurable settings for the Active Lane Management
system are available within the Uconnect system
Úpage 197.
Selectable Warning Types:
Vibration Only
Steering Assist Only
Vibration And Steering Assist
Other configurable settings for this system are for the
intensity of the vibration (high/med/low), steering assist
strength (hi/med/low), and the warning zone sensitivity
(early/medium/late).
NOTE:
The system will not apply vibration and/or steering
assist to the steering wheel whenever a safety system
engages (Anti-Lock Brakes, Traction Control System,
Electronic Stability Control, Forward Collision Warning,
etc.).
The Blind Spot Monitoring system will be forced on
when the ALM system is enabled.
The ALM system will be suppressed when the Active
Driving Assist system (if equipped) is engaged.
PARKVIEW REAR BACK UP CAMERA
Your vehicle is equipped with the ParkView Rear Back Up
Camera that allows you to see an on-screen image of the
rear surroundings of your vehicle whenever the gear
selector is put into REVERSE. The image will be displayed
on the Navigation/Multimedia radio display screen along
with a caution note to “Check Entire Surroundings” across
the top of the screen. After five seconds this note will
disappear. The ParkView camera is located on the rear of
the vehicle above the rear license plate.
When the vehicle is shifted out of REVERSE with camera
delay turned off, the rear camera mode is exited and the
previous screen appears.
Manual Activation Of The Back Up Camera
1. Press the Vehicle button located on the bottom of
the Uconnect display and then select the Controls
menu.
2. Press the Back Up Camera icon to turn the Rear View Camera system on.
NOTE:
The Rear View camera can also be turned on manually
through the Apps menu within the Uconnect system.
The ParkView Rear Back Up Camera has program -
mable modes of operation that may be selected
through the Uconnect system
Úpage 197. When the vehicle is shifted out of REVERSE with camera
delay turned off, the rear camera mode is exited and the
previous screen appears. When the vehicle is shifted out
of REVERSE with camera delay turned on, the camera
image will continue to be displayed for up to 10 seconds
unless the following conditions occur: the vehicle speed
exceeds 8 mph (13 km/h), the vehicle is shifted into
PARK, the vehicle’s ignition is placed in the OFF position,
or the touchscreen X button to disable the display of the
Rear View Camera is pressed.
When enabled, active guidelines are overlaid on the image
to illustrate the width of the vehicle and its projected back
up path based on the steering wheel position. A dashed
center line overlay indicates the center of the vehicle to
assist with parking or aligning to a hitch/receiver.
Different colored zones indicate the distance to the rear of
the vehicle.
The following table shows the approximate distances for
each zone:
Zone Distance To The Rear Of The
Vehicle
Red 0 - 1 ft
(0 - 30 cm)
Yellow 1 ft - 6.5 ft
(30 cm - 2 m)
Green 6.5 ft or greater
(2 m or greater)

SERVICE THE NIGHT VISION SYSTEM
When service conditions are present, the following fault
messages may appear in the instrument cluster display
when the vehicle is placed in the ON position.
If "Night Vision Unavailable Sensor Blocked" appears in
the instrument cluster display, make sure the camera is
clear of snow, ice, mud, dirt or other debris. The camera is
located in the upper fascia/bumper, inside the driver side
grille slot. Clean the camera using a soft wet cloth or by
pressing the Clean Camera button in the Uconnect
system. If the message continues to appear after cycling
the ignition, see an authorized dealer.
If “Night Vision Temporarily Unavailable” or “Night Vision
Unavailable Service Required" appears in the instrument
cluster display after cycling the ignition, see an authorized
dealer.
The camera must be properly aligned to work correctly.
If the camera needs adjustment, see an authorized
dealer. Do not attempt to adjust the camera yourself.
NOTE:Alignment and performance of the Night Vision may be
affected by aftermarket modifications. Mopar® parts
should be used to get the optimal performance of this
system.
NIGHT VISION SYSTEM LIMITATIONS
The Night Vision display is deactivated under the following
conditions:
Vehicle is shifted into REVERSE
The ignition is not in the ON/RUN position
The headlights are off and the vehicle speed is greater
than 8 mph (13 km/h)
The Night Vision display warnings are suppressed under
the following conditions:
Daylight hours
Temperatures above 86°F (30°C)
The system may not be fully functional in the following
situations:
On steep hills
On tight curves of the road
If the camera/sensor is damaged or blocked by dirt,
snow, ice, or other debris
In poor visibility conditions such as heavy fog, rain,
snow, or other weather conditions
If the vehicle has been modified with aftermarket parts
and/or accessories
NOTE:If any of these conditions are present, the system does not
need service.
WARNING!
Night Vision can only detect pedestrians and animals
located within the range of the infrared camera.
Night Vision may not detect pedestrians or animals
and highlight them if:
They are not in an upright position, for example
if they are sitting or lying down, or if the pedes -
trian is riding a bicycle
The figure in the display appears incomplete, for
example because the pedestrian or animal is
partially behind a vehicle
The pedestrian/animal is not directly ahead in
the coverage area
The pedestrian/animal is part of a group
The pedestrian is wearing certain types of
clothing
The pedestrian/animal is moving too quickly
through the field of view
The sensor is blocked by dirt, rain, snow, or ice

TRAILER HITCH RECEIVER COVER
R
EMOVAL — IF EQUIPPED
Your vehicle may be equipped with a trailer hitch receiver
cover, this must be removed to access the trailer hitch
receiver. This cover is located at the bottom center of the
rear fascia/bumper.
1. Turn the three locking retainers located at the
bottom of the hitch receiver cover a quarter turn
counterclockwise and pull bottom of the hitch
receiver cover outward (towards you).
2. Pull the bottom of the cover outward (towards you) then downwards to disengage the tabs located at the
top of the hitch receiver cover to remove.
Hitch Receiver Cover
To reinstall the cover after towing repeat the procedure in
reverse order.
NOTE:Be sure to engage all tabs and fully seat the hitch receiver
cover in the fascia/bumper prior to installation of the
quarter turn fasteners.

TRAILER AND TONGUE WEIGHT
Never exceed the maximum tongue weight stamped on
your bumper or trailer hitch.
Weight Distribution
Consider the following items when computing the weight
on the rear axle of the vehicle:
The tongue weight of the trailer.
The weight of any other type of cargo or equipment put
in or on your vehicle.
The weight of the driver and all passengers.
NOTE:Remember that everything put into or on the trailer adds
to the load on your vehicle. Also, additional
factory-installed options or dealer-installed options must
be considered as part of the total load on your vehicle.
Refer to the Tire And Loading Information Placard for the
maximum combined weight of occupants and cargo for
your vehicle.
TOWING REQUIREMENTS
To promote proper break-in of the new vehicle drivetrain
components, the following guidelines are recommended. Perform the maintenance listed in the Scheduled
Servicing
Úpage 309. When towing a trailer, never
exceed the GAWR or GCWR ratings.
WARNING!
Always load a trailer with 60% of the weight in the front
of the trailer. This places 10% of the GTW on the tow
hitch of your vehicle. Loads balanced over the wheels or
heavier in the rear can cause the trailer to sway
severely side to side which will cause loss of control of
the vehicle and trailer. Failure to load trailers heavier in
front is the cause of many trailer collisions.CAUTION!
Do not tow a trailer at all during the first 500 miles
(805 km) the new vehicle is driven. The engine, axle
or other parts could be damaged.
Then, during the first 500 miles (805 km) that a
trailer is towed, do not drive over 50 mph (80 km/h)
and do not make starts at full throttle. This helps the
engine and other parts of the vehicle wear in at the
heavier loads.
WARNING!
Make certain that the load is secured in the trailer
and will not shift during travel. When trailering cargo
that is not fully secured, dynamic load shifts can
occur that may be difficult for the driver to control.
You could lose control of your vehicle and have a
collision.
When hauling cargo or towing a trailer, do not over -
load your vehicle or trailer. Overloading can cause a
loss of control, poor performance or damage to
brakes, axle, engine, transmission, steering, suspen -
sion, chassis structure or tires.
Safety chains must always be used between your
vehicle and trailer. Always connect the chains to the
hook retainers of the vehicle hitch. Cross the chains
under the trailer tongue and allow enough slack for
turning corners.
Vehicles with trailers should not be parked on a
grade. When parking, apply the parking brake on the
tow vehicle. Put the tow vehicle transmission in PARK
(P). For four-wheel drive vehicles, make sure the
transfer case is not in NEUTRAL (N). Always, block or
"chock" the trailer wheels.
GCWR must not be exceeded.

Integrated Trailer Brake Module (ITBM)
The user interface consists of the following:
Manual Brake Control Lever
Slide the manual brake control lever to the left to activate
power to the trailer's electric brakes independent of the
tow vehicle's brakes. If the manual brake control lever is
activated while the brake is also applied, the greater of the
two inputs determines the power sent to the trailer brakes.
The trailer and the vehicle's brake lamps will come on
when either vehicle braking or manual trailer brakes are
applied. Trailer Brake Status Indicator Light
This light indicates the trailer electrical connection status.
If no electrical connection is detected after the ignition is
turned on, pushing the GAIN adjustment button or sliding
the manual brake control lever will display the GAIN
setting for 10 seconds and the Trailer Brake Status
Indicator Light will not be displayed.
If a fault is detected in the trailer wiring or the ITBM, the
Trailer Brake Status Indicator Light will flash.
GAIN Adjustment Buttons (+/-)
Pushing these buttons will adjust the brake control power
output to the trailer brakes in 0.5 increments. The GAIN
setting can be increased to a maximum of 10 or
decreased to a minimum of 0 (no trailer braking).
GAIN
The GAIN setting is used to set the trailer brake control for
the specific towing condition and should be changed as
towing conditions change. Changes to towing conditions
include trailer load, vehicle load, road conditions and
weather.
Adjusting GAIN
NOTE:This should only be performed in a traffic free environment
at speeds of approximately 20–25 mph (30–40 km/h).
1. Make sure the trailer brakes are in good working condition, functioning normally and properly
adjusted. See a trailer dealer if necessary.
2. Hook up the trailer and make the electrical connections according to the trailer manufacturer's
instructions. 3. When a trailer with electric/EOH brakes is plugged in,
the trailer connected message should appear in the
instrument cluster display (if the connection is not
recognized by the ITBM, braking functions will not be
available), the GAIN setting will illuminate and the
correct type of trailer must be selected from the
instrument cluster display options.
4. Push the UP or DOWN button on the steering wheel until “TRAILER TOW” appears on the screen.
5. Push the RIGHT arrow on the steering wheel to enter “TRAILER TOW”.
6. Push the UP or DOWN buttons until the “Trailer Brake Type” appears on the screen.
7. Push the RIGHT arrow and then push the UP or DOWN buttons until the proper Trailer Brake Type appears
on the screen.
8. In a traffic-free environment, tow the trailer on a dry, level surface at a speed of 20–25 mph
(30–40 km/h) and squeeze the manual brake
control lever completely.
9. If the trailer wheels lockup (indicated by squealing tires), reduce the GAIN setting; if the trailer wheels
turn freely, increase the GAIN setting.
Repeat steps 8 and 9 until the GAIN setting is at a point
just below trailer wheel lockup. If towing a heavier trailer,
trailer wheel lockup may not be attainable even with the
maximum GAIN setting of 10.

When To Use 4WD LOW — If Equipped
When off-road driving, shift to 4WD LOW for additional
traction. This range should be limited to extreme
situations such as deep snow, mud, or sand where
additional low speed pulling power is needed. Vehicle
speeds in excess of 25 mph (40 km/h) should be avoided
when in 4WD LOW.
Driving Through Water
Although your vehicle is capable of driving through water,
there are a number of precautions that must be
considered before entering the water.
NOTE:Your vehicle is capable of water fording in up to 20 inches
(51 cm) of water, while crossing small rivers or streams. To
maintain optimal performance of your vehicle's heating
and ventilation system it is recommended to switch the
system into recirculation mode during water fording. Driving through water more than a few inches/
centimeters deep will require extra caution to ensure
safety and prevent damage to your vehicle. If you must
drive through water, try to determine the depth and the
bottom condition (and location of any obstacles) prior to
entering. Proceed with caution and maintain a steady
controlled speed less than 5 mph (8 km/h) in deep water
to minimize wave effects.
Flowing Water
If the water is swift flowing and rising (as in storm run-off),
avoid crossing until the water level recedes and/or the
flow rate is reduced. If you must cross flowing water avoid
depths in excess of 9 inches (23 cm). The flowing water
can erode the streambed, causing your vehicle to sink into
deeper water. Determine exit point(s) that are
downstream of your entry point to allow for drifting.
Standing Water
Avoid driving in standing water deeper than 24 inches
(60 cm), and reduce speed appropriately to minimize
wave effects. Maximum speed is 5 mph (8 km/h).Maintenance
After driving through deep water, inspect your vehicle
fluids and lubricants (engine oil, transmission oil, axle,
transfer case) to ensure the fluids have not been
contaminated. Contaminated fluid (milky, foamy in
appearance) should be flushed/changed as soon as
possible to prevent component damage.
Driving In Snow, Mud And Sand
In heavy snow, when pulling a load, or for additional
control at slower speeds, shift the transmission to a low
gear and shift the transfer case to 4WD LOW if necessary
Úpage 129. Only shift into a lower gear to maintain
forward motion. Over-revving the engine can spin the
wheels and traction will be lost.
Avoid abrupt downshifts on icy or slippery roads, because
engine braking may cause skidding and loss of control.
Hill Climbing
NOTE:Before attempting to climb a hill, determine the conditions
at the crest and/or on the other side.
Before climbing a steep hill, shift the transmission to a
lower gear and shift the transfer case to 4WD LOW. Use
FIRST gear and 4WD LOW for very steep hills.
WARNING!
Do not drive in 4WD LOW on dry pavement; driveline
damage may result. 4WD LOW locks front and rear
drivelines together and does not allow for differential
action between the front to rear driveshafts. Driving in
4WD LOW on pavement will cause driveline binding;
use only on wet or slippery surfaces.
CAUTION!
When driving through water, do not exceed 5 mph
(8 km/h). Always check water depth before entering as
a precaution, and check all fluids afterward. Driving
through water may cause damage that may not be
covered by the New Vehicle Limited Warranty.

If you stall or begin to lose forward motion while climbing
a steep hill, allow your vehicle to come to a stop and
immediately apply the brakes. Restart the engine, and
shift into REVERSE (R). Back slowly down the hill, allowing
the compression braking of the engine to help regulate
your speed. If the brakes are required to control vehicle
speed, apply them lightly and avoid locking or skidding the
tires.
Remember, never drive diagonally across a hill. Always
drive straight up or down.
If the wheels start to slip as you approach the crest of a
hill, ease off the accelerator and maintain forward motion
by turning the front wheels slowly. This may provide a fresh
“bite” into the surface and will usually provide traction to
complete the climb.Traction Downhill
When descending mountains or hills, use Hill Descent
Control or Selec-Speed Control to avoid repeated heavy
braking.
If not equipped with Hill Descent Control or Selec-Speed
Control use the following procedure:
Shift the transmission into a low gear, and the transfer
case into 4WD LOW range. Let the vehicle go slowly down
the hill with all four wheels turning against engine
compression drag. This will permit you to control the
vehicle speed and direction.
When descending mountains or hills, repeated braking
can cause brake fade with loss of braking control. Avoid
repeated heavy braking by downshifting the transmission
whenever possible.
After Driving Off-Road
Off-road operation puts more stress on your vehicle than
does most on-road driving. After going off-road, it is always
a good idea to check for damage. That way you can get any
problems taken care of right away and have your vehicle
ready when you need it.
Completely inspect the underbody of your vehicle.
Check tires, body structure, steering, suspension, and
exhaust system for damage.
Inspect the radiator for mud and debris and clean as
required.
Check threaded fasteners for looseness, particularly
on the chassis, drivetrain components, steering, and
suspension. Retighten them, if required, and torque to
the values specified in the Service Manual.
Check for accumulations of plants or brush. These
things could be a fire hazard. They might hide damage
to fuel lines, brake hoses, axle pinion seals, and
propeller shafts.
After extended operation in mud, sand, water, or
similar dirty conditions, have the radiator, fan, brake
rotors, wheels, brake linings, and axle yokes inspected
and cleaned as soon as possible.
If you experience unusual vibration after driving in
mud, slush or similar conditions, check the wheels for
impacted material. Impacted material can cause a
wheel imbalance and freeing the wheels of it will
correct the situation.
WARNING!
If the engine stalls, you lose forward motion, or cannot
make it to the top of a steep hill or grade, never attempt
to turn around. To do so may result in tipping and rolling
the vehicle. Always back carefully straight down a hill in
REVERSE gear. Never back down a hill in NEUTRAL
using only the brake.
WARNING!
Abrasive material in any part of the brakes may cause
excessive wear or unpredictable braking. You might not
have full braking power when you need it to prevent a
collision. If you have been operating your vehicle in dirty
conditions, get your brakes checked and cleaned as
necessary.
